VDD arrests a supporter of Russian war crimes and an instigator of hatred against Latvians

In the video calls published on TikTok, the person expressed support for Russia and its extended military aggression against Ukraine, as well as aggressively and hostilely addressed Latvians and other residents of Latvia who support Ukraine.

On April 25, the service also carried out criminal procedural activities in one person-related facility near Riga. During the criminal proceedings, the service took out several data carriers, personal records, as well as clothing and other items with symbols of Russia and the Soviet Union for further investigation.

The person came to the attention of the VDD as early as 2023 in connection with aggressive comments on the social networking site “Facebook”, in which he expressed support for Russia. In August last year, the Ministry of Internal Affairs and Communications conducted preventive discussions with this person, warning that his activities in the Internet environment are approaching criminal offenses for which criminal liability is provided.

The suspect has been remanded in custody as a security measure.

VDD will provide additional information on the progress of the investigation according to the progress of the criminal process.
